County child support division welcomes new deputy director

| | Comments (0)


The San Bernardino County Department of Child Support Services welcomes its new deputy director, Marci Jensen-Eldred, who began her new job last month. She will oversee the department's case establishment and intake teams.

Jensen-Eldred served as the director for the Sutter County Department of Child Support Services since May 2006. Sutter County had a key role as a
pilot county in the roll out of the statewide child support case
management system from 2006 to 2008.

Jensen-Eldred earned a bachelor of arts degree from California State
University, Sacramento and a Juris Doctorate from Lincoln Law School in
Sacramento.

"Marci Jensen-Eldred has demonstrated a high level of skill and
commitment to California's children. I know she will continue to
maintain this level of excellence in San Bernardino County," said Connie Brunn, director of San Bernardino County's child support services division.
